A Fun Day for a Great Cause

The Glen Cove Rotary Club and Friends of the Glen Cove Youth Board are co-hosting the 2026 Duck Derby Fundraiser to benefit both organizations.

Enjoy great music, family fun, food, prizes, and the thrill of cheering on your adopted duck as the race gets underway at Pryibil Beach.
